MORPHOLOGICAL CHARACTERIZATION OF WHEAT GERMPLASM FOR YIELD AND YIELD RELATED TRAITS

Abstract

Evaluation and identification of superior genotypes for general cultivation is the key objective of plant breedings programs. To investigate genotypic differences among exotic wheat germplasm and association between yield and yield associated attribute in wheat genetics, scientific research was Khalil Bin Ismail NJBS (2024) 5: 2 July – December, 2024 35 done at Agriculture Research Station, Baffa, Mansehra in 2021. Fifty genotypes including 49 exotic wheat genotypes and one check cultivar were sown in Randomised Complete Block (RCB) design with three replications. Data were recorded on plant length (cm), spike length(cm), 1000-grains weight (gm), days to emergence, number of heads and days to maturity, biological yield (kg), tiller m-2 , yield plot-1 (kg). Significants variation were noted among all the genotypes i.e plants height (cm), 1000 grain weight (gm), days to emergence , heading and maturity days, biological yields (kg), tiller m', grains yield (kg) length of spike (cm). Maximum plants height (104 cm), spikes length (11.63 cm), 1000 grain weight (39.3 gm), emergence days(20 days), days to headings (116 days), days to maturity (180.3 days), biological yield (11.9 kg), tiller m-2 ( 574) and grains yield (3.56 kg) were recorded for genotpye G43, G37, G37, G19, G48, G11, G40, G37 and G37, respectively. Grains yield depicted significant correlation with spike lengths, 1000 grains weight and tiller m-2 ; whereas, significant negative correlation with plant height and biological yield showed that these traits needs to be measured in determining selections criteria for grains yield improvement. Heritability evaluations revealed high values for all the parameters viz. plant height (0.83), 1000-grain weight (0.83), emergence days (0.61), days for heading (0.85), date to physiological maturity (0.72), biological yield (0.65), grain yield (0.77), tiller m-2 (0.84) and spike length (0.70). Selection response estimates revealed low values for the traits under study viz. plant height (7.9), 1000-grain weight (1.2), day to emergence (1.14), days to heading (2.892), days to maturity (2.65), biological yields (0.34), grain yield (0.59) but moderate for spike length (15.58) and high for parameter like tiller m-2 (25.49). Genotype G37, G3 and G38 produced maximum grain yield and thus should be suggested for breeding wheat and varietal development programme in future.
